As well as wearing something spotty to school, the pupils from Innerwick, danced their way through a version of Saturday Night by Whigfield, to raise money for Children in Need.
Thank you to Miss Heatherill for organising and choreographing this.
Much fund was had by everyone and we raised £83.00 for Children in Need.

The dates set to enrol children who would like to be admitted into P1 at Innerwick Primary School for the Session 2012/2013 are TUESDAY 15th NOVEMBER & WEDNESDAY 16th NOVEMBER 2011.
A copy of our school handbook along with an information leaflet about enrolling your children in an East Lothian Council school will be sent to all parents/carers of our pre-school nursery pupils.
Can you please arrange to phone the school office to arrange a time to come into the office on either of these dates to see Tina McAvoy and complete the School enrolment form.
You MUST bring along your child’s birth certificate and proof of residence as part of the enrolment process. The ONLY form of identification of residence that we are able to accept is a council tax assessment letter.
If you are not able to attend on either of these dates, please phone the office to make alternative arrangements.
